What is a Meat Vacuum Mixer?


A meat vacuum mixer is a specialized machine that combines meat with other ingredients under vacuum conditions. This process reduces the amount of air in the mixture, preventing oxidation and spoilage while ensuring uniform distribution of flavors and additives. The vacuum environment also aids in better binding of proteins, which enhances the texture of the final product. These mixers are commonly used in the production of sausages, marinated meats, and other processed meat products.


Factors Influencing the Price of Meat Vacuum Mixers


Several factors play a role in determining the price of meat vacuum mixers. Understanding these factors can help businesses make informed purchasing decisions.


1. Capacity One of the primary determinants of price is the capacity of the mixer. Smaller models suitable for low-output production lines may start at a lower price point, while larger, industrial-scale mixers designed to handle high volumes can be significantly more expensive.


2. Material and Build Quality The durability and resistance to corrosion of the materials used in construction heavily influence costs. High-quality stainless steel mixers typically come at a higher price due to their longevity and ease of cleaning.

3. Technology and Features Modern mixers incorporate advanced technology such as programmable controls, integrated cooling systems, and automated functions that optimize the mixing process. These additional features, while enhancing efficiency, can also increase the overall cost.


4. Brand Reputation Established brands with a proven track record of quality and service often command higher prices. Investing in a reputable brand can assure users of lasting reliability and effective after-sales support.


5. Market Conditions Market fluctuations, supply chain issues, and economic factors can impact the prices of machinery. Companies may experience variations in costs based on current demand, material availability, and economic conditions.


Typical Price Range


The price of meat vacuum mixers can vary widely, typically ranging from a few thousand to several tens of thousands of dollars. Small-scale, entry-level models may be found in the range of $3,000 to $10,000. Mid-range options equipped with decent capacity and features usually fall between $10,000 and $25,000. For high-capacity, commercial-grade options, prices can soar to $30,000 or more.
